Christmas will be another tough time
The organiser of a fund to help those whose properties were damaged in the Laxey floods warns it will be months before they're back in their homes.
Garff Commissioner Nigel Dobson has announced the Laxey Fund will be matching the government emergency payment of £500.
It was confirmed last week 37 applications have been made for the Manx Government grant.
Mr Dobson says Christmas will be another hard time for victims of the flooding:
